Phase III of the Dutchess Rail-Trail, opened on May 26. The trail, which will eventually be 12 miles, follows the former Maybrook Rail corridor and a water transmission line runs beneath it. The third phase links the Towns of LaGrange, Wappinger, and East Fishkill and creates more than 8 miles of continuous trail. Dutchess County [...] [...]

The New York State Underwater Blueway Trail Project is searching for potential dive partners to participate in the project. The UBT will include the Village of Lake George (Lake George), Villages of Freeport (Atlantic Ocean), the cities of Dunkirk (Lake Erie), Geneva (Seneca Lake), Oswego (Ontario Lake) and Plattsburgh (Lake Chaplain). Information is now posted about the Hiking 101/201 program on the Finger Lakes Trail website. This is a series of 4 hikes on the last Sunday of June, July, August & September that are family friendly and are shorter than the FLTC traditional County Hike Series hikes. WYNN, Click here to watch VIDEO The Syracuse Parks Conservancy opened the area’s first Urban Environment Trail at Sunnycrest Park Friday. The trail took eight years to complete. The trail begins at Henninger High School, passes through Sunnycrest Parks’ McDermott Butterfly Garden and ends at the Louis Mariani Peace Garden. The trail’s creators are hoping [...] [...]
